Washington, D.C. — Today, Rep. Barry Moore voted in support of H.R. 3564, the Middle Class Borrower Protection Act. This legislation would end the Biden Administration's recent rule that punishes Americans with good credit scores. The rule mandates borrowers with good credit ratings pay higher fees to cover those with poor credit ratings.

Washington, D.C. — Last week, Rep. Barry Moore introduced the bicameral, bipartisan Forest Data Modernization Act with co-author Rep. Kim Schrier (D-WA). This legislation modernizes the technologies and data collection methods used by the Forest Inventory and Analysis Program to meet growing market demand and support sustainable forest management decisions.
